About the role:
Our web3 project is a visionary initiative aimed at creating the future cross asset marketplace that “enables anybody, anywhere to trade any amount of any asset for any other asset at any time." This innovative platform seeks to democratize access to all types of assets, including those traditionally unavailable to many (e.g. Treasuries) fostering greater financial inclusion globally.
The Business Development Manager – Strategic Partnerships is responsible for:
· Pipeline Development & Prospecting
· Proof of Concept (PoC) Scoping
· NDA and Contract Management
· Project Execution & Delivery Oversight
· Market & Technology Engagement
· Cross-Functional Collaboration
Responsibilities:
· Identify, qualify, and secure a pipeline of prospects, transforming potential opportunities into a robust client list.
· Develop strategic partnerships and engage key decision-makers across industries relevant to the project.
· Collaborate with technical and product teams to define and scope Proofs of Concept (PoCs) that demonstrate the value of the project.
· Ensure alignment between business needs and technical capabilities, driving early validation and feedback
· Facilitate and oversee the execution of Non-Disclosure Agreements (NDAs) and other initial contractual arrangements.
· Ensure all documentation complies with legal and regulatory requirements, collaborating closely with legal teams as necessary.
· Support the Product Owner and Head of Strategic Distribution in managing project timelines, scope, resources, and risk.
· Provide regular status updates to stakeholders, ensuring clear communication across internal teams and external partners.
· Leverage a deep understanding of Web3 market trends, tokenization, DeFi principles, and smart contracts to guide business development initiatives.
· Maintain knowledge of enterprise blockchain solutions, regulatory frameworks, and emerging DeFi protocols to inform strategic decisions.
· Work closely with solution architecture, pre-sales engineering, and project/program management teams to deliver comprehensive client solutions.
· Foster collaboration between technical teams and external partners to ensure seamless integration and project success.
· 3-5 years of proven business development experience, ideally in technology, fintech, blockchain, or related sectors.
· Demonstrated success in building and managing a sales pipeline, securing strategic partnerships, and executing PoCs.
· Solid understanding of Web3, tokenization, and DeFi principles.
· Familiarity with smart contracts, enterprise blockchain solutions, and the regulatory landscape surrounding these technologies.
· Experience in solution architecture, project/program management, or pre-sales engineering is a plus.
· Strong strategic thinking and problem-solving skills with an ability to operate in a dynamic and fast-paced environment.
·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ively engage with stakeholders at all levels.
· Proven track record of managing multiple projects simultaneously with a high degree of professionalism and initiative.
· Ability to work collaboratively across various teams and geographies.
· Experience with enterprise-level projects and navigating complex business environments.

What does a sales in web3 do?
As a sales in the field of web3, the individual would be responsible for selling web3 products and services to clients
This would involve identifying potential clients, building relationships with them, and presenting the benefits of the web3 products and services in a way that is compelling and relevant to the client's needs
The salesperson would also be responsible for negotiating contracts and pricing with clients, as well as providing support and guidance throughout the sales process
Additionally, the salesperson may be involved in developing sales strategies and tactics, and tracking and analyzing sales data to identify trends and opportunities for improvement
Overall, the main responsibility of a salesperson in the web3 field is to drive sales and revenue for the company.
